Enchanted Glasses is a fascinating early fantasy piece from Segundo de Chomón, who really knew how to play with visual tricks and practical effects. The film features a devilish man who dances with a floating dress, which adds a surreal charm. The appearance of the magician in the dress is another highlight, showcasing some clever editing techniques of the time. Then there’s this whole sequence where she conjures up six women who disappear just as quickly, all while shifting into men’s clothing. It’s a mesmerizing blend of illusion and performance, capturing the wonder of early cinema. The pacing is brisk, keeping you engaged with its whimsical and slightly eerie atmosphere that feels quite unique for a 1907 film.
